Google has a system of paid advertising which charges its customers for every time a link is clicked on. On the right hand side of the Google results screen is a list of links that someone has paid for. A customer puts a certain amount of money into their Google account and puts the key words into the system that they are willing to pay for. Then every time someone clicks on the link a little bit of money is deducted from their account.
